3
adding an app tile
Click the START button., Look for the app you want to add as an app tile from the list of app and then right-click on it., Click on the PIN TO START option.

5
Removing an app tile
Righ-click on the app tile, Click on the unpin from start option

7
Resizing an app tile
Right-click on the app tile, Click on the size you want from the list
